Emergency services attended to an overturned vehicle following a two-car collision in Barrowford.
Fire crews from Nelson and Colne were called to the scene in Church Street at around 1.08pm on Thursday October 18.
An elderly female driver had flipped her vehicle onto its roof after hitting another car while travelling along the road.
A spokesperson from the fire service said: "We attended an incident where a vehicle had crashed into another, overturned and landed on its roof.
"An elderly female had managed to get herself out of car and was being seen to by paramedics, who were at the scene along with the police."
A small amount of damage was reported on both vehicles, and nobody is believed to have been seriously injured as a result of the crash.
Fire crews were in attendance for around 40 minutes and a recovery vehicle arrived to remove the overturned car.
